Election information

Published: May 03. 2012 4:00AM PST

Oregon’s primary election will take place May 15.

• The deadline for registration to participate in the May primary was April 24.

• Current voters must update their registration in writing if their residence or mailing address has changed. Voters can accomplish this by submitting a new voter registration card to the county clerk’s office or updating registration online at www .oregonvotes.org.

• The deadline for changing party affiliation for the May primary was April 24. To change party affiliation for future elections, submit a new voter registration card to the county clerk’s office or update online at www.oregon votes.org.

• Every returned ballot signature is verified against the signature in the voter’s registration. If a voter’s signature has changed, the voter should submit a new voter registration card with the current signature.

• There is now an Independent Party in Oregon. If a voter does not want to be affiliated with any party, select on the voter registration card “Not a member of a party.”

• Ballots were mailed April 27. They cannot be forwarded.

• Absentee forms are available online and at the county clerk’s office if a voter will be away from home for one or more elections.

• Voter registration cards are available at city halls, libraries, DMV offices, post offices, county clerks’ offices, the last page of the government section (blue pages) of the Qwest Dex Phone book or online at www.deschutes.org/clerk or www.oregon votes.org.

For more inform-ation, go online to www .deschutes.org/clerk or www.oregonvotes.org.
